单词 casual
释义
Casual
adj satadj.allmarked by blithe unconcern
Synset:insouciant nonchalant
Examples:
  • an ability to interest casual students
  • showed a casual disregard for cold weather
  • an utterly insouciant financial policy
  • an elegantly insouciant manner
  • drove his car with nonchalant abandon
  • was polite in a teasing nonchalant manner
Antonyms:concerned
Derivationally Related Form:casualnessinsouciancenonchalance
Inherited Hypernyms:casual
Similar to:unconcerned
adj satadj.allwithout or seeming to be without plan or method; offhand
Examples:
  • a casual remark
  • information collected by casual methods and in their spare time
Antonyms:planned
Derivationally Related Form:casualness
Inherited Hypernyms:casual
Similar to:unplanned
adj satadj.allappropriate for ordinary or routine occasions
Synset:daily everyday
Examples:
  • casual clothes
  • everyday clothes
Antonyms:formal
Derivationally Related Form:casualness
Inherited Hypernyms:casual
Similar to:informal
adj satadj.alloccurring or appearing or singled out by chance
Synset:chance
Examples:
  • seek help from casual passers-by
  • a casual meeting
  • a chance occurrence
Antonyms:planned
Derivationally Related Form:casualness
Inherited Hypernyms:casual
Similar to:unplanned
adj satadj.allhasty and without attention to detail; not thorough
Synset:cursory passing perfunctory superficial
Examples:
  • a casual (or cursory) inspection failed to reveal the house's structural flaws
  • a passing glance
  • perfunctory courtesy
  • In his paper, he showed a very superficial understanding of psychoanalytic theory
Antonyms:careful
Derivationally Related Form:casualness
Inherited Hypernyms:casual
Similar to:careless
adj satadj.alloccurring on a temporary or irregular basis
Synset:occasional
Examples:
  • casual employment
  • a casual correspondence with a former teacher
  • an occasional worker
Antonyms:regular
Derivationally Related Form:casualness
Inherited Hypernyms:casual
Similar to:irregular
adj satadj.allcharacterized by a feeling of irresponsibility; it is no fooling matter"
Synset:fooling
Examples:
  • a broken back is nothing to be casual about
Antonyms:heavy
Derivationally Related Form:casualness
Inherited Hypernyms:fooling
Similar to:light
adj satadj.allnatural and unstudied
Synset:free-and-easy
Examples:
  • using their Christian names in a casual way
  • lectured in a free-and-easy style
Antonyms:formal
Derivationally Related Form:casualness
Inherited Hypernyms:free-and-easy
Similar to:informal
adj satadj.allnot showing effort or strain
Synset:effortless
Examples:
  • a difficult feat performed with casual mastery
  • careless grace
Antonyms:difficult
Derivationally Related Form:casualnesseffortlessness
Inherited Hypernyms:casual
Similar to:easy
